1,900 sq.ft custom home, garage and workshop constructed using prefabricated SIP's panels, with custom interior cabinets, doors and finishes. The design of this house is an attempt to develop an architectural iconography which celebrates the history and uniqueness of the land upon which it’s built. The house sits in an irrigated hayfield along with some of the original machinery that used to work here, and reflects the design sensibilities of a common sense agricultural outbuilding as seen through contemporary eyes.

Although they are not visible, it is important to note that this home was built with SIPs, or Structural Insulated Panels, which means that it is 15 times more airtight than a traditional home! With fewer gaps in the foam installation, we can optimize the home's energy performance while improving the indoor air 9uality. This modern construction techni9ue can reduce framing time by as much as 50% without compromising structural strength.

The wine room was designed as both a functional storage space and an immersive entertaining experience, showcasing a collection of over 2,000 bottles within a carefully crafted architectural setting. Custom wine racks provide organized, high-capacity storage while creating a rich visual texture throughout the space. An open area allows for gathering and conversation, transforming the room into a destination for entertaining rather than simply storage. A full-height glass wall and panel system maintains visual openness and puts the collection on display from adjacent spaces, adding depth and atmosphere to the interior architecture. The combination of glass, steel, and wood creates a sophisticated environment that celebrates craftsmanship, hospitality, and the homeowner’s passion for wine.
